TABLE WEAVINGS

Two sophisticated, practical textile collections, inspired by local artisan traditions and designed to complete the elegantly appointed Cassina table.
Drawn from the artisan traditions of Myanmar and Friulan wicker handiwork, Together is a simple, elegant accessory to light-hearted entertaining.

Fiore di Loto – Céston

Local artisan tradition inspires a sophisticated design project for the table in two textile collections – elegant, practical placemats in two fabrics and two patterns. Together draws upon the handiwork of Myanmar, where the long-neck women start with yarn from lotus flowers to create soft, uneven weaves. The placemats, on the other hand, are reminiscent of the Friulan basket-making tradition, starting with woven wicker which creates geometric patterns based on simple shapes, that forms the support for the plate.
